  • the invention relates to a tappet for a valve train of an internal combustion engine, with a hollow cylindrical shirt, one end with is connected to a floor for a cam contact.
  • Such a tappet comes from the DE considered as generic 41 15 668 A1. It is equipped with a hydraulic lash adjuster Mistake. The disadvantage is its relatively massive training, especially in Floor area. Because of this, the oscillating masses are in the valve train unnecessarily increased or excessive valve train work can be determined.
  • the object of the invention is therefore to provide a tappet of the aforementioned type to create that is optimized in terms of its weight.
  • this object is achieved in that the shirt is a significantly lower in height than the tappet overall, with the bottom tapered roof-like is lifted from the front.
  • This roof-like "raising" of the floor leads to an increase in rigidity in this area. This, in turn, can reduce the thickness of the soil can be significantly reduced to about 1.2 mm. At the same time, that by the concomitant reduction in a shirt's height and a Total area of the floor is now less area to be finished. This has an advantageous effect on production costs and effort.
  • the floor rectangular, so that from the face of the shirt two parallel sides in the direction of the floor extend, but may also be a truncated cone-like design can be realized with a circular bottom. However, the latter only lies a relatively small contact area for the cam on the floor.
  • the parallel sides to the floor are also trapezoidal side designs u. conceivable.
  • the bottom surface in the cam contact direction to run slightly cylindrical. This is a larger contact area generated for the cam.
  • the bottom with the sides and the shirt is advantageously made in one piece.
  • multi-part training is also conceivable, for example in a joining process.
  • At least one applied to the inside of the bottom can be stiffened Stiffening rib may be provided.
  • Stiffening rib may be provided.
  • an inner piston of the play compensation element lie against the stiffening ribs and at the same time there is a simple way to transfer oil from the plunger reservoir realized in a pantry of the game compensation element.
  • the floor generally has a thickness of approximately 1.2 mm to train. This can be done by optimizing stiffness using FEM calculations be created. Previous tappets have a minimal Bottom thickness of about 1.8 mm.
  • the single figure discloses a tappet 1 consisting of a hollow cylindrical shirt 2 with a cam-side face 3. From the face 3 extend two opposite, here concave Pages 4, which converge towards each other in the cam contact direction. Pages 4 turn into a floor 5 for direct cam contact.
  • This bottom 5 has a rectangular shape in plan view is made with a slightly cylindrical bulge.
  • a stiffening rib 6 can be seen on an inside 7 of the base 5 (Two stiffening ribs 6 located opposite one another like a kidney are provided - see introduction to the description). One lies on these stiffening ribs 6 Inner piston 8 of a hydraulic lash adjuster 9. Furthermore is shown that in the shirt 2 a recess 10 for an anti-rotation 11 is applied. The cup tappet 1 is secured via this anti-rotation device 11 in a longitudinal groove of a receptacle of a cylinder head of an internal combustion engine guided.
